The South Florida home to see the biggest price cut today is a seven-bedroom, seven-bathroom house at 9001 Banyan Drive in Coral Gables. The $4.9 million Dade County home saw its price cut by $1 million, or 17 percent. The residence was listed for $5.9 million when it first hit the market in July. The 9,903-square-foot home sits at the tip of Hammock Lake.
Gary Shear of Roy Owen Realty Association has the listing. (Condo Vultures data includes condos and single-family home listings in the main metropolitan areas of Miami, Fort Lauderdale, West Palm Beach and Key West that are priced at $1 million and above, and that include photographs. Listings are taken from the South Florida MLS.) TRD
